1. MXGP Series
The MXGP series is a highly acclaimed motocross racing game that prides itself on authenticity. It features officially licensed tracks and riders from the Motocross World Championship, which adds a layer of realism that fans appreciate. The game excels in its physics engine, making every jump and turn feel genuine. Multiplayer modes and career progression keep the game fresh and challenging.
2. Trials Rising
Trials Rising is a fun yet challenging moto 3d game that focuses more on precision and balance than outright speed. Players navigate intricate obstacle courses filled with ramps, gaps, and tricky surfaces. The game’s physics engine requires careful control of throttle and brake, offering a unique blend of puzzle-solving and motorbike riding. Its bright, cartoonish style and multiplayer options provide a casual yet competitive experience.
3. Ride 4
Ride 4 boasts an impressive roster of motorcycles and tracks, making it a dream for motorbike enthusiasts. Known for its photorealistic graphics and detailed bike customization, this game stands out for players who want a near-simulation experience. The dynamic weather and day-night cycle add complexity to races, requiring adaptability and strategic thinking.

Understand the Importance of Traction and Balance
Maintaining traction and balance is crucial, especially in off-road or motocross games. Learn to shift your weight appropriately during turns and jumps to avoid crashes. This skill often distinguishes beginner players from advanced riders.
Customize Your Bike Strategically
If your game allows bike customization, experiment with different setups to find what suits your style and the race conditions. Lighter bikes may be faster but less stable, while heavier bikes might offer better control on rough terrains.

Simulation vs. Arcade Style
Simulation moto 3d games focus on replicating real-world physics and bike handling, often appealing to hardcore fans who want an authentic experience. These games usually feature detailed bike customization, realistic tracks, and require a learning curve.
On the other hand, arcade-style moto 3d games emphasize fast-paced action and accessibility. They often feature exaggerated stunts, power-ups, and more forgiving controls. These games are perfect for casual players looking for quick thrills.
Freestyle and Stunt Riding Games
Some moto 3d games center around performing tricks and stunts rather than racing to the finish line. Players can execute flips, wheelies, and complex combos to score points. These games test creativity and timing and often feature vibrant environments and upbeat soundtracks.

Comparative Analysis: Moto 3D Games vs. Traditional Racing Games
While moto 3d games share commonalities with other racing game subgenres, such as car racing or arcade-style bike racing, they distinguish themselves through the unique handling characteristics of motorcycles. The balance and lean angles required in moto 3d games introduce a complexity that is absent in car racing simulators.
Moreover, moto 3d games often emphasize stunt mechanics, providing players with the opportunity to perform tricks mid-air during jumps. This feature is less prevalent in traditional racing games and adds an element of risk-reward gameplay. Titles like "MotoGP" series focus more on realistic racing, whereas games such as "MX vs ATV" blend racing with freestyle motocross, highlighting the diversity within the moto 3d game category.

Technical Challenges in Developing Moto 3D Games
Developers face unique obstacles when creating moto 3d games. Balancing realism with accessibility remains a persistent challenge. Overly realistic physics can alienate casual gamers, while simplified controls might frustrate simulation enthusiasts seeking authenticity.
Optimization is another critical concern. Rendering detailed 3D environments and complex animations demands significant processing power, especially on mobile platforms or lower-end hardware. Consequently, developers must refine their graphics pipelines and implement scalable settings to accommodate a broad player base.
AI programming also requires meticulous attention. Computer-controlled opponents must exhibit human-like behavior, adapting to track conditions and player strategies without appearing predictable or unfair. Achieving this balance enhances the competitive experience, especially in single-player modes.
